Secondly, what are 3 adaptations of a cactus?

Eg cactus plants:

  • thick, waxy skin to reduce loss of water and to reflect heat.
  • large, fleshy stems to store water.
  • thorns and thin, spiky or glossy leaves to reduce water loss.
  • spikes protect cacti from animals wishing to use stored water.
  • deep roots to tap groundwater.
  • long shallow roots which spread over a wide area.
Moreover, what are 5 adaptations of a cactus? These adaptations include – spines, shallow roots, deep-layer stomata, thick and expandable stem, waxy skin and a short growing season.

How does a succulent survive without water?

Succulents can go months, seasons, and sometimes a lifetime, without water and survive just fine. … Their extensive root systems have adapted to drinking and storing water reserves in their leaves and stems. When they need water, they tap their reserves. It’s pretty amazing what these tiny but mighty succulents can do.

Why do succulents hold water?

Succulents hold moisture in their leaves, stems and tissues. They use these stored water to survive in dry conditions. Too much water is deadly to these plants. But they still need to be watered in order to survive and thrive.

What adaptation do you see in cactus plants?

Spines which are modified leaves. These minimise the surface area and so reduce water loss. The spines also protect the cacti from animals that might eat them. Very thick, waxy cuticle to reduce water loss by evaporation .
